郑州十大java入门培训学校
来源:教育联展网 编辑:佚名 发布时间:2021-12-15
荣誉见证辉煌,实力铸就品牌,缔造年轻人的中国梦。风雨兼程十九载,砥砺前行记初心,达内和学子一同成长。26大课程体系,助推学员更好发展,紧跟市场脉搏,让学员多方向选择。实战中走出来的讲师,满满都是干货,讲师来自于多家IT企业。
Java基础知识
获取 Class 对象的方式
1.Class.forName("全类名"),源代码阶段,它能将字节码文件加载进内存中,然后返回 Class 对象,多用于配置文件中,将类名定义在配置文件中,通过读取配置文件来加载类。
2.类名.class,类对象阶段,通过类名的 class 属性来获取,多用于参数的传递。
3.对象.getClass(),运行时阶段,getClass() 定义在 Object 类中,表明所有类都能使用该方法,多用于对象的获取字节码的方式。
我们首先定义一个 Person 类,用于后续反射功能的测试;定义好 Person 类之后,我们尝试用 3 种不同的方式来获取 Class 对象,并比较它们是否相同。上述代码中,会发现最后输出的比较结果返回的是两个 true,说明通过上述三种方式获取的 Class 对象都是同一个,同一个字节码文件(*.class)在一次运行过程中只会被加载一次。
![](https://pic.thea.cn/Public/Uploadpic/20211206/1638759745.png)
Java小白必看
Java分析器和为什么需要它们
轻量级Java事务分析器
XRebel和Stackify Prefix等产品。
轻量级分析器通过将自身注入代码中,在跟踪应用程序时采用不同的方法。方面分析器使用面向方面编程(AOP)将代码注入指定方法的开始和结束。注入的代码可以启动计时器,然后在方法完成时报告经过的时间。这些分析器的设置很简单,但您需要知道要评测什么。有关示例,请参见Spring AOP方法评测。Java代理探查器使用Java Instrumentation API将代码注入到应用程序中。由于代码是在字节码级别重写的,因此此方法可以更好地访问应用程序。这允许检测应用程序中运行的任何代码,无论是您编写的代码还是您的应用程序所依赖的第三方库。查看Java代理简介,了解这一切是如何工作的。Aspect Profiler非常容易设置,Java代理在跟踪深度方面有很大优势。
![](https://pic.thea.cn/Public/Uploadpic/20211206/1638759993.png)
Java的实用知识
Java编辑器与开发
NetBeans,说到Java,NetBeans是最流行的IDE之一。它是开源的,具有强大的功能,包括:1)支持多种语言;2)一组丰富的插件,如ResinTemplateModule for Java和PHP;为iOS、Android和Windows开发本地Java应用程序的插件;CSS缩小器;还有更多;3)现成的Git和Maven集成;4)调试器和配置文件,以帮助分析和修复代码中的错误。
EclipseIDE,EclipseIDE是另一个**的工具,54%的Java开发人员使用它。与NetBeans一样,它也是开源的,并带有大量插件和可定制的界面。在一系列其他功能中,它还提供代码完成帮助、语法检查和重构。
![](https://pic.thea.cn/Public/Uploadpic/20211206/1638759686.png)
零基础需要了解的关于Java
Java前景好吗?
Java:是一种面向对象的编程语言,可以做很多事情,但主要是写后端,处理一些逻辑功能,基本上你能用到的,有后台的东西Java都能做。举例来说,用户登录,您输入用户名和密码,后端就是用于计算您输入的用户名和密码是否正确等等。Java前景不错想必每个人都很清楚,Java一直是非常稳定的,而且Java作为一种通用的编程语言,目前已在许多领域得到广泛应用。可以说无论在国外还是国内都发展地非常完善,所以Java开发人员不仅有广阔的市场前景和大量的工作岗位,而且因为Java技术含量高,Java开发者的工资也相当可观。
![郑州十大java入门培训学校](https://pic.thea.cn/Public/Uploadpic/1565058213.jpg)
about us
达内致力于面向IT互联网行业,培养软件开发工程师、测试工程师、系统管理员、智能硬件工程师、UI设计师、网络营销工程师、会计等职场人才。2015年起,推出面向青少年的少儿编程、智能机器人编程、编程数学等K12课程。